[...]Trump campaign manager Corey Lewandowski confirmed to The Washington Post that Trump would "definitely not" participate in Thursday's Fox News debate.

“He’s definitely not participating in the Fox News debate," Lewandowski said. "His word is his bond."

He said Trump would remain in Iowa as planned and would instead host an event in the state to raise money for wounded warriors and other veterans groups.

Trump has made such threats before, but he said that the Fox News Channel, which is hosting the debate Thursday night, had gone too far by issuing press statements on Tuesday that he said mocked his concern about Megyn Kelly, one of the debate co-moderators.

"They're dealing with someone who's a little bit different. They can't toy with me like they toy with everybody else," he added.

When Trump saw the press release from Fox, "I said, 'Bye bye,'" he said.
